Why High-Value Item Insurance Matters in Jackson, TN

Jackson combines Arkansas border-town hospitality with Tennessee’s rich cultural legacy. Many residents inherit antiques, handmade quilts, or collectibles with histories spanning generations. Others own luxury items, such as engagement rings, vintage guitars, collectible sports gear, or art by local artists. These items often exceed the standard policy limits of homeowners or renters insurance.

Regular insurance policies typically have caps (for example, $1,500 for jewelry or $2,500 for electronics), which may not be enough to fully cover a single high-value item, let alone a collection. Getting the right coverage can be the difference between a minor inconvenience and a major financial setback.

How Does High-Value Item Insurance Work?

High-value item insurance provides broader—and sometimes all-risk—protection. Unlike standard policies, it covers more scenarios (like accidental loss or mysterious disappearance) and pays out the full insured value. There are generally two ways to protect these items:

  • Scheduled Personal Property Endorsement: Also known as "scheduling," this add-on to your standard policy allows you to list specific items and their values. For example, if you have a $10,000 engagement ring, you can schedule it for that full value.
  • Standalone High-Value Item Policy: If you have a large amount of valuables, some insurers offer stand-alone policies for collections or specific categories, such as a policy just for your art collection or wine cellar.

Steps to Insure High-Value Items in Jackson

1. Take Inventory

Start by making a list of all high-value items. Include photographs, descriptions, receipts, and appraisals. In Jackson, where tornadoes and severe weather can strike, having a digital backup of your records is wise.

2. Get Items Appraised

Get a professional appraisal to determine the current replacement cost. Local Jackson, TN jewelers, antique shops, or certified appraisers can help document your item's true value—a key requirement for insurers.

3. Review Policy Limits and Options

Check your current insurance policy for coverage limits and exclusions. In Jackson, ask a local agent about high-value endorsements or standalone policies tailored to regional needs, such as tornado or flood risk.

4. Choose the Coverage That Fits

  • Agreed Value Coverage: Pays you the full insured value (not depreciated).
  • Replacement Cost Coverage: Replaces the item at today’s prices, even if it’s increased in value.
  • Cash Value: Pays out what the item is worth today, minus depreciation (usually the least favorable option).

5. Update Coverage Regularly

As you acquire new pieces or as their values change, update your coverage accordingly. Items passed down through generations in Jackson may appreciate or gain historical significance.

Common High-Value Item Insurance Questions in Jackson, TN

Do I Need Specialized Insurance If I Have a Home Security System?

A security system may qualify you for insurance discounts, but it doesn’t replace the need for adequate coverage. Jackson residents who invest in alarm systems can ask their insurers about credits but shouldn’t lower limits on valuables based solely on security.

What About High-Value Items in Storage or College Dorms?

Items kept off-premises—such as antiques in storage units or electronics with kids at the University of Memphis Lambuth—may have restricted coverage. Be sure your Jackson insurance provider knows where your valuables are kept.

Does High-Value Item Insurance Cover Natural Disasters?

Jackson’s history with tornadoes, floods, and storms means natural disaster coverage is crucial. Standard policies may exclude certain disasters, so ask for endorsements or separate flood insurance for full protection.

How Can I Prove Ownership or Value After a Loss?

Detailed documentation is your best ally. In Jackson, many residents film walk-through videos of their homes, highlighting high-value items and collections, and store them securely in the cloud or a safe-deposit box.
